Description Suggest change

A fun, short corner that offers something different and moderate to do at Kinsman. Clip the fixed knife blade from a stance atop the flake in the corner. Great pick torques and delicate feet for the first few moves to gain the now wider crack which will take small cams. Follow the crack to the frozen turf above and belay at a fixed anchor. This anchor and the one on the starting ledge can also serve as an alternate rappel line for the ‘The Beast’ on those busy, crowded weekends. 

Location Suggest change

Climb The Beast to just through the crux curtain then step down and right to the tree ledge. Or climb the independent, steeper yellow pillar just right of The Beast and be deposited on the ledge right below the corner. Scramble up a move past a small birch tree into an alcove with the teetering flake (solid) in the corner.

Protection Suggest change

One fixed knife blade, purple C3 to .5 Camalot (x2), small wires would work as well.
